My current Switch is defect and I replaced it with an unmanaged one. Since then I've a lot of dropouts with streaming through roon with RAAT or AIR. I had this issue also before, but I had the possibility to configure the switch to 100mb. No I don't. Any idea?
Avatar
Manson
Am Donnerstag um 07:52
Hello Marco,

Hope you are well.

As I know, when you are using Roon Raat, you can configure the output to 100Mb to avoid the drop out issue.

And if you are using Roon with Devialet Air instead, you should be able to stream with the highest quality.

Have you tried these options already? If not, please explain your setup more precisely then I will get the question to escalate to my engineer.

Marco, I had a similar issue with my expert pro 220. I found a 25 euro fix (at least it's working fine so far): I bought a basic 10/100 5-port switch. Connected 1 port to my gigabit switch and 1 port to the Devialet. Issue resolved as far as I can tell.

How do you reproduce the problem? In contrast to most of the users, I did not have such a problem in my system. The only difference between my system and most of others' is that I use two different switches between the audio-related components(Mac Mini, Devialet) and other network devices(such as NAS, TV, Internet Router). These two switches are connected to each other by using a fiber-optic connection. The Ethernet outputs on these switches are all Gigabit-Ethernet enabled. I can play large DSD256, DSD64 audio files over the network by using Roon(it converts the DSD256 stream to DSD64)
